PSCT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

86 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co S&P SmallCap Information Technology ETF (PSCT)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$82M — up 4.7% from $78.4M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 14 funds closed out of PSCT and 8 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 25 trimmed existing stakes and 23 added.

The largest buyer was Royal Bank of Canada, adding an estimated $1.08M. The largest seller was Flow Traders U.S., exiting entirely with an estimated $2.02M sold.
